Herbal Nutrition™ is the largest directory of Herbalife International distributors worldwide.
Are you a distributor in Streamwood, IL? List your distributorship here today!
127 South Maxon Lane
Streamwood, Illinois 60107
https://herbalnutrition.com/usa1